Driving directions from Lanzhou, China to Odala, Philippines distance


Lanzhou, China
Odala, Philippines
Lanzhou to Odala road map

Lanzhou to Odala flight distance miles / km

1,882.4 mi / 3,029.4 km
Also see in China
Of interest in Philippines